DeepMind vs. Google Brain: A Battle for AI Supremacy

DeepMind and Google Brain, two powerhouses in the field of artificial intelligence, are engaged in a fierce competition for supremacy. Both organizations boast groundbreaking achievements, pushing the boundaries of what AI can achieve. DeepMind, known for its deterministic approaches, has made waves with AlphaGo and AlphaZero, demonstrating remarkable proficiency in game playing. Conversely, Google Brain, leveraging its vast data sets, has achieved significant strides in machine learning, powering applications like Google Assistant and object detection.

The rivalry between these two entities is not just about bragging rights. It fuels innovation, driving the rapid advancement of AI and its influence on society. The outcome of this competition will undoubtedly shape the future of artificial intelligence and its role in our future.

The Algorithms Collide: Moral Implications of AI vs. AI

In a future increasingly shaped by artificial intelligence, the potential for conflict between autonomous systems is a burgeoning concern. Envision a world where sophisticated algorithms, each designed with distinct objectives, collide. The outcomes of such collisions could be profound, raising complex ethical issues about responsibility, bias, and the very nature of intelligence.

  • Significant issue arises from the potential for divergent goals. Two AI systems, programmed to optimize different metrics, may arrive at mutually contradictory solutions.
  • Furthermore, the inherent complexity of AI processes can make it impossible to foresee the results of such interactions.
  • In essence, navigating the ethical landscape of AI vs. AI necessitates a careful analysis of potential risks and the development of robust safeguards to reduce harm.
